 | /* | 
 |  * hpsb_packet_success - Make sense of the ack and reply codes and | 
 |  * return more convenient error codes: | 
 |  * 0           success | 
 |  * -EBUSY      node is busy, try again | 
 |  * -EAGAIN     error which can probably resolved by retry | 
 |  * -EREMOTEIO  node suffers from an internal error | 
 |  * -EACCES     this transaction is not allowed on requested address | 
 |  * -EINVAL     invalid address at node | 
 |  */ | 
 | int hpsb_packet_success(struct hpsb_packet *packet); |

 | /* | 
 |  * The generic read, write and lock functions.  All recognize the local node ID | 
 |  * and act accordingly.  Read and write automatically use quadlet commands if | 
 |  * length == 4 and and block commands otherwise (however, they do not yet | 
 |  * support lengths that are not a multiple of 4).  You must explicitly specifiy | 
 |  * the generation for which the node ID is valid, to avoid sending packets to | 
 |  * the wrong nodes when we race with a bus reset. | 
 |  */ | 
 | int hpsb_read(struct hpsb_host *host, nodeid_t node, unsigned int generation, | 
 | 	      u64 addr, quadlet_t *buffer, size_t length); | 
 | int hpsb_write(struct hpsb_host *host, nodeid_t node, unsigned int generation, | 
 | 	       u64 addr, quadlet_t *buffer, size_t length); |
